all: add freebsd supports
This commit add support for ctrld to run on freebsd, supported platforms are amd64/arm64/armv6/armv7,386. Supporting freebsd also requires adding debian and openresolv resolvconf. Updates #47

# This script is a workaround for a vpn-unfriendly behavior of the
|
||||||
|
# original resolvconf by Thomas Hood. Unlike the `openresolv`
|
||||||
|
# implementation (whose binary is also called resolvconf,
|
||||||
|
# confusingly), the original resolvconf lacks a way to specify
|
||||||
|
# "exclusive mode" for a provider configuration. In practice, this
|
||||||
|
# means that if Ctrld wants to install a DNS configuration, that
|
||||||
|
# config will get "blended" with the configs from other sources,
|
||||||
|
# rather than override those other sources.
|
||||||
|
#
|
||||||
|
# This script gets installed at /etc/resolvconf/update-libc.d, which
|
||||||
|
# is a directory of hook scripts that get run after resolvconf's libc
|
||||||
|
# helper has finished rewriting /etc/resolv.conf. It's meant to notify
|
||||||
|
# consumers of resolv.conf of a new configuration.
|
||||||
|
#
|
||||||
|
# Instead, we use that hook mechanism to reach into resolvconf's
|
||||||
|
# stuff, and rewrite the libc-generated resolv.conf to exclusively
|
||||||
|
# contain Ctrld's configuration - effectively implementing
|
||||||
|
# exclusive mode ourselves in post-production.
